Hey, a word of advice! If you decide to tint the windows, don’t forget that you will need to wait three days until you can use the convertible and windows! Thankfully, someone thoughtfully designed that amazing sunroof feature! Whew! I was almost crushed; not completely, of course, considering how much fun the MINI is to drive regardless.
